Windows 10 acceptă acum Tar și cURL
Începând cu Windows 10 Build 17063, Windows 10 vine cu un nou pachet de instrumente care sunt comune în lumea sistemelor de operare asemănătoare Unix. Sistemul de operare are porturi native pentru două instrumente populare open-source bsdtar și curl. Iată câteva detalii.
Ce sunt gudronul și curl
Aceste două instrumente sunt utilizate pe scară largă în lumea Linux. Dacă nu sunteți familiarizat cu ele, iată o scurtă descriere a acestor aplicații.
- Gudron: Un instrument de linie de comandă care permite unui utilizator să extragă fișiere și să creeze arhive. În afara PowerShell sau a instalării unui software terță parte, nu exista nicio modalitate de a extrage un fișier din cmd.exe. Corectăm acest comportament. Implementarea pe care o livrăm în Windows o folosește libarchive.
- Răsuci: Un alt instrument de linie de comandă care permite transferul de fișiere către și de la servere (deci puteți, să zicem, să descărcați acum un fișier de pe internet).
Sunt disponibile pe toate editiile de Windows 10.
Cum se folosește gudron și curl
Ambele instrumente pot fi pornite dintr-o fereastră de prompt de comandă. Aceștia acceptă setul tradițional de comutatoare.
Puteți afla mai multe despre ei citind ajutorul lor. start tar --ajutor
și curl --ajutor
la promptul de comandă.
Puteți folosi comanda tar -x
pentru a extrage arhivele TAR și opțiunea tar -c
pentru a le crea.
Merită menționat faptul că PowerShell are o serie de cmdlet-uri care pot înlocui sau replica funcționalitatea curl.
Deși este o schimbare bună din orice punct de vedere, utilizatorii obișnuiți de Windows 10 nu vor beneficia de ea. Există o mulțime de instrumente de arhivare grafică, inclusiv 7-Zip, PeaZip, WinRAR, WinZip etc. Mulți dintre aceștia pot crea o arhivă TAR imediată. Instrumentele portate sunt utilitare de consolă și necesită lucrul cu argumentele lor din linia de comandă, așa că este greu de imaginat un utilizator mediu care le folosește. Sunt grozave pentru dezvoltatorii care lucrează cu sisteme de operare diferite și cu servicii și aplicații multiplatforme. Pentru acești dezvoltatori care folosesc Windows 10, aceasta este o schimbare utilă.
Deci, versiunile moderne de Windows 10 au o integrare strânsă cu Linux. Ei vin deja cu un consolă Linux cu funcții complete, incorporat Client SSH și Server SSH, iar acum includ gudron și curl. Utilitățile ar trebui să ajungă în ramura stabilă în martie 2018, cu următoarea actualizare a caracteristicilor „Redstone 4”. Puteți citi noutățile din viitoarea actualizare aici:
Ce este nou în Windows 10 Redstone 4